In a completely unfettered free market, the logical model is club specific TV season tickets with income split between broadcaster and club but it becomes difficult to negotiate that collectively because the broadcaster and United/Lpool would probably be rolling in it for their 38 games but Bournemouth sales probably aren't going to cover the cost of the film crew.They've had a ridiculous business model. Thousands of pounds for 100s of games you dont want and only 75% of the games you do.
I would probably pay to watch all 38 of our games and nothing else but it does depend on how much
The collectively negotiated TV deal has to some extent, lessened the gap between richest and poorest and you can see why the Sly 6 in particular hate it.
Broadcasters have almost got round the 3pm blackout for PL games by moving so many of them away from that slot and generally leaving less enticing fixtures in that slot anyway.
